Nutrient HiVeg™ Broth, pH 6.9 w/o NaCl
Intended use
Recommended as general purpose medium for the cultivation of microorganisms.
Composition
| Ingredients | g/L |
|---|---|
| HiVeg® peptone | 5.000 |
| HiVeg® extract | 3.000 |
| Final pH (at 25°C) | 6.9±0.2 |
**Formula adjusted, standardized to suit performance parameters
Directions
Suspend 8.0 grams in 1000 ml purified/distilled water. Heat if necessary to dissolve the medium completely. Dispense into tubes or flasks as desired. Sterilize by autoclaving at 15 lbs pressure (121°C) for 15 minutes.
Principle And Interpretation
Nutrient Broth with pH 6.9 and devoid of NaCl is a relatively simple formulation containing HM Peptone B and peptone which can support the growth of non-fastidious microorganisms. It provides nitrogenous and carbonaceous compounds, long chain amino acids and other essential growth nutrients. It has the formula originally developed for use in Standard Methods for the Examination of Water and Waste Water (1). Nutrient HiVeg® Broth, pH 6.9 w/o NaCl is same as Nutrient Broth, pH 6.9 w/o NaCl except that the animal based peptones are completely replaced with the vegetable peptones to avoid the BSE/TSE risks associated with animal peptones.
HiVeg® peptone and HiVeg® extract provides nitrogenous and carbonaceous compounds, long chain amino acids and other essential growth nutrients. If this medium is incorporated with 6.5% sodium chloride, then it acts as a differential and selective agent by interfering with the osmotic balance and the permeability of membrane of majority of microorganisms. On addition of 6.5% Sodium chloride, the medium can also be used to determine salt tolerance of bile esculin positive Enterococci (2).

Quality Control
Appearance
Cream to yellow homogeneous free flowing powder
Colour and Clarity of prepared medium
Light amber coloured clear solution without any precipitate
Reaction
Reaction of 0.8% w/v aqueous solution at 25°C. pH : 6.9±0.2
Cultural Response
pH
6.70-7.10
Cultural characteristics observed after an incubation at 35-37°C for 18-48 hours.
| Organism | Inoculum (CFU) |
Growth |
|---|---|---|
| # Klebsiella aerogenes ATCC 13048 (00175*) |
50-100 | good-luxuriant |
| Enterococcus faecalis ATCC 29212 (00087*) |
50-100 | good-luxuriant |
| Escherichia coli ATCC 25922 (00013*) |
50-100 | good-luxuriant |
| Salmonella Typhi ATCC 6539 |
50-100 | good-luxuriant |
| Staphylococcus aureus subsp. aureus ATCC 25923 (00034*) |
50-100 | good-luxuriant |
| Staphylococcus epidermidis ATCC 12228 (00036*) |
50-100 | good-luxuriant |
Key: *Corresponding WDCM numbers # Formerly known as Enterobacter aerogenes
Storage and Shelf Life
Store between 10-30°C in a tightly closed container and the prepared medium at 15-30°C. Use before expiry date on the label. On opening, product should be properly stored dry, after tightly capping the bottle in order to prevent lump formation due to the hygroscopic nature of the product. Improper storage of the product may lead to lump formation. Store in dry ventilated area protected from extremes of temperature and sources of ignition Seal the container tightly after use. Product performance is best if used within stated expiry period.
